Paul Meyer's Baseball Rankings: 8/20/06
Sunday, August 20, 2006
(Last week's rankings in parentheses)

Rank, team The skinny
1. Detroit Tigers (1) Polanco loss a huge blow.
2. New York Mets (3) Their cruise encountering rough seas.
3. Chicago White Sox (4) Winning series in Detroit a must.
4. New York Yankees (2) Given the Birds before Boston.
5. Minnesota Twins (5) Santana unbeaten in Dome.
6. Boston Red Sox (6) Love these visits by Yankees.
7. Oakland Athletics (8) Mariners should get an A's playoff share.
8. Toronto Blue Jays (9) Does Halladay ever lose?
9. St. Louis Cardinals (7) Cubs are Redbirds' nemeses.
10. Los Angeles Dodgers (12) Ran into big school of Fish.
11. Los Angeles Angels (11) More like devils against Rangers.
12. Cincinnati Reds (10) Were this close in St. Louis.
13. Texas Rangers (15) Another setback for The Kipster.
14. Arizona Diamondbacks (14) Batista loss-less since June 9.
15. Philadelphia Phillies (18) Rollins leads wild-card charge.
16. San Diego Padres (13) Giant visit a huge bummer.
17. San Francisco Giants (21) Geezers get a second wind.
18. Colorado Rockies (19) Castilla to retire as a Rockie.
19. Houston Astros (17) Not much of a wild-card spurt.
20. Milwaukee Brewers (20) Same with this crew.
21. Florida Marlins (22) Don't Josh around when Johnson starts.
22. Atlanta Braves (23) Is Villareal for real?
23. Seattle Mariners (16) Texas sweep furled their sails.
24. Cleveland Indians (26) Starters have been outstanding.
25. Baltimore Orioles (24) Bullpen needs major overhaul.
26. Washington Nationals (25) Astacio's gem tarnishes Braves.
27. Chicago Cubs (27) Dusty watch is on big-time.
28. Tampa Bay Devil Rays (28) Upton continues to struggle at top.
29. Pirates (30) Sweep of Cardinals worth step up.
30. Kansas City Royals (29) Road record is ridiculous.
